                Dieffenbachia Amoena has large, waxy, green leaves that are mottled with white, cream or yellow blotches. As its lower leaves are shed its stem becomes more evident.
* This plant is toxic if leaves are ingested.

        Conocarpus
            Conocarpus is a broadleaf evergreen tree that can withstand drought, salt, heat, and high winds. Its brown bark is flaky and attractive. Throughout the year, flushes of greenish-white and purple flowers are produced but are not showy or noticeable.

        Little Leaf Boxwood
            Boxwood has traditional landscape use, just think of old English or French gardens. It has a small evergreen ovate leaves where the venation does show at all. The leaves are about 1cm. The flowers are born in the leaf axis but unnoticeable for the eye.

        Aloe Vera
            True aloe is an outstanding ornamental succulent that is cultivated outdoors, and indoors as a potted plant for sunny exposures. This clump forming succulent plant produces rigid upright rosettes of light green, thick, lance-like leaves edged with tiny yellow teeth.
